URL Shortening algorithms
Hash-based
- Hash each URL to produce shortened version
- Only 1 shortened domain per URL
- Risk of collisions
Incremental
- Generate shortened URLs sequentially
- One URL can be stored multiple times
- No collisions
Interesting attack possibilities
Hash-based
- URL poisoning through collisions
- Figure out hashing algorithm
- Shorten URL containing lots of junk padding
- Depending on the shortener, the new URL may replace existing one shortened
Incremental
- Date tracking
- Create URL every 24 hours
- Determine when target URLs were shortened
- Extract URLs for time period
Character Set
- Base62
- Very easy to guess

The Attack: URL Harvesting
Determine character set and URI length for targeted shortener
Determine case sensitivity by modifying an existing URL
All tested shorteners tested use location header redirects (HEAD requests)
Create URLs to harvest
Profit
Examples:
Photobucket –> Security based on knowing the link
Google Docs –> Knowing the shared link gives access to the shared data

Parasitic Storage
- Base64 encode your file
- Split it into chunks
- Optionally, encrypt each chunk
- “shorten” each chunk as a URL
- Retrieve it later in chunk form
- Decrypt, combine
Each chunk can be 256Kb or larger
Tools like TinyDisk offer automated way to achieve this.

How can shorteners be more secure?
- URL Harvesting
- Password protected URLs (Trick.ly!)
- Throttling
- Temporary lockout on brute-force attempts
- Especially for non-existant URLs
- Parasitic Storage
- Multiple Shortenings
- Disallow known shortened links
- Attacks
- Filter out common XSS artifacts
- Compare URLs to list of known badware (some already do)
How can we protect ourselves?
- Stop shortening sensitive URLs
- Stop putting sensitive data into URLs
- Check shortened URLs before accessing them (longurlplease)
